Users are not receiving an expected error notification when attempting to perform an action related to their timesheets, despite restrictions related to their new hire date.
All supported releases
The absence of an error is due to the presence of an open timesheet record in the database.
This open timesheet is automatically created in the database when a user navigates or "scrolls" through the time periods on a timesheet interface.
Engineering has reviewed this behavior and determined that this would be considered a Usability Enhancement for future consideration by the Product team.
Although an open timesheet exists in the database, Clarity enforces a restriction that prevents the user from entering or updating any time on timesheets that fall before their official new hire date.
